--- Comment #2 from Adam S. <laroucheyouth at yahoo.com> 2008-01-21 12:02:13 ---
Yes, it is. I am using CRT (not secure CRT, which is the same thing, minus the
SSL capabilities) and need to use a serial port, COM1 38400 N,8,1 xon/xoff, and
I am experiencing very similar issues. The cpu usage no longer spikes, but the
screen wont draw properly if the local port is not receiving a constant stream
of data to draw on the screen.
So, for instance, I can actually login into my VT200 system, without actually
being able to see the login prompts by simply entering my username and
password. When i get a prompt, if I enter gibberish and press enter a bunch of
times, I can see the prompt errors. But, as soon as I stop, the screen stops
refreshing.
Again, If I run a program, the output will display just fine, until the program
stops printing data to the terminal. When the program sits at a prompt, waiting
for me to enter a command, the screen stops refreshing again.
